River Falls school superintendent search is down to three
The school board and its superintendent advisory committee interviewed seven candidates for the job of school superintendent. School Board president Stacy Johnson Myers said three finalists have been picked: Barry Cain, Ellsworth Community School District superintendent; Donald Haack, Spooner Area School District; and James Benson, River Valley School District in Spring Green.

UPDATE: RF Police still asking for public's help in murder investigation
Police continue to ask for the public's assistance in its search for a laptop computer and computer bag believed to be Aaron Schaffhausen’s. Schaffhausen has been charged with the murders of his three daughters in River Falls Tuesday, July 10. These items may have been ditched along the road by Schaffhausen before he turned himself in. Items in question are a Sony VAIO laptop and a Targus laptop bag.

River Falls battery suspect steals truck, goes for joyride
A 20-year-old local man allegedly punched his girlfriend in the face five times before getting away on foot at 233 W. Cascade Ave. last Thursday, June 28, after 1 a.m. Police searched all over but couldn’t find their suspect. The man had found an unlocked pickup truck with keys in the ignition in the 500 block of North Clark Street. He got in, drove off, stopped for gas at the downtown Holiday station, then drove off again toward St. Cloud, Minn., stopping to pull over for a nap.
